A Global Team of Experts
Meet the Team
Dan Radu
For over 15 years, Dan has been a proven B2B marketing and technology leader building the right teams and solutions for his clients. Global marketing teams work with him to scale their modern sales & marketing organizations.
Connect with Dan on LinkedIn >

Join Our Team




















How Macro Can Help You
Why Marketing Leaders Want to Work With Us
- Increase revenue and scale your supporting digital operations
- Execute our crafted partner marketing strategies, tailored to your unique needs
- Optimize and streamline your operations as we seamlessly integrate with your team
- Streamline the processes between different teams and accelerate your GTM implementation
- Utilize the latest data-driven trends and thoughts, provided by us
- Revitalize your content marketing and design with our team of experts
- Have our tech and operations experts embedded directly into your team, and boost your capacity
- Become more efficient and economical with your data – use only the good data, none of the bad data
- Create magical virtual experiences with our experienced webinar management and tailored support
- Improve your customer experiences with the latest in digital tech
- Understand the capabilities of your tech stack through our knowledge and guidance
- Make full use out of Salesforce, Pardot, Marketo, Hubspot, Zinfi, Zift, and more!
Want to work with our team?
How We Work
Managed Services
Ongoing Support
We know that you have a lot of things on your plate. To help alleviate your workload, our advisers will support you and your marketing team – providing extra hands (and brains)!
We’ll make your tasks our number one priority, adapting to your work style and providing what you need to help you get the job done.
We recommend this option for when you’re looking to fill a long-term ongoing capability or capacity gap on your team.
Agile Marketing Sprints
Complete a Project Faster
Sometimes your organization may have capacity gaps that are temporary. As a result, you may be looking for marketing agencies to help you fill this gap – that’s where Macro comes in.
As part of our services, we can offer resources to you on a per project basis to help speed up project completion.
We recommend this option for situations when your workload for a particular project is too much to handle and an extra hand is needed.
MarTech Partnerships & Recognitions


.png)